Ein gutes online casino ohne limit überzeugt oft durch hohe Einsatzmöglichkeiten, moderne Spielautomaten und attraktive Freispiele. Viele Spieler bevorzugen Plattformen mit schnellen Auszahlungen, sicherer Zahlungsabwicklung und mobiler Unterstützung. Besonders beliebt bleiben außerdem Live Casino Spiele mit echten Dealern.

Фундамент программирования для начинающих

Фундамент программирования для начинающих

Программирование представляет собой процесс построения инструкций для компьютера. Эти директивы позволяют машине осуществлять конкретные действия и процедуры. Современный мир невозможно представить без программного обеспечения. Программы на смартфонах, ресурсы в интернете, механизмы управления транспортом — все это результат работы разработчиков.

Новичкам специалистам существенно изучить основополагающие понятия. Элементарные знания включают понимание того, как компьютер обрабатывает данные. Машина не распознаёт людской язык непосредственно. Разработчики употребляют специфические языки программирования для общения с аппаратурой.

Маршрут в разработке начинается с освоения основных основ. Каждый язык содержит свой синтаксис и нормы записи директив. Новичкам необходимо освоить рассуждать алгоритмически. Такой метод помогает расчленять сложные задания на серию простых этапов.

Обучение нуждается упражнений и настойчивости. Написание начальных приложений способно показаться трудным. Тем не менее постоянные упражнения совершенствуют навыки и уверенность. Дефекты в скрипте — естественная компонент течения учёбы. Способность отыскивать и устранять их развивает профессиональное мышление программиста вулкан.

Что такое кодирование и зачем оно требуется

Программирование является инструментом контроля цифровыми комплексами через написание скрипта. Скрипт формируется из инструкций, которые компьютер интерпретирует и производит. Разработчики создают программы для автоматизации монотонных операций. Автоматизация сберегает время и сокращает число дефектов.

Нынешние технологии внедрились во все отрасли существования. Врачебное техника применяет программное обеспечение для диагностики. Финансовые платформы обрабатывают миллионы транзакций каждодневно. Заводские линии регулируются компьютерными приложениями для повышения эффективности.

Навык разрабатывать программу даёт широкие карьерные перспективы. Эксперты в сфере казино вулкан востребованы в разных отраслях хозяйства. Предприятия подбирают экспертов для разработки новых сервисов. Способности разработки обеспечивают преодолевать необычные проблемы изобретательными подходами.

Написание приложений тренирует рациональное мировоззрение и аналитические умения. Кодер учится организовывать данные и находить эффективные варианты. Знание основ действия электронных устройств превращает индивида более компетентным потребителем технологий.

Как сформированы программы и команды

Приложение является собой цепочку директив для компьютера. Каждая команда осуществляет специфическое операцию. Устройство воспринимает директивы сверху вниз и производит их по очерёдности. Подобная структура зовётся прямым способом выполнения.

Директивы оформляются на языках программирования с использованием специального синтаксиса. Синтаксис определяет правила написания кода. Компилятор или интерпретатор переводит созданный программу в компьютерный язык, понятный процессору.

Программы состоят из многообразных модульных частей. Функции организуют команды для выполнения конкретных действий. Модули группируют родственные функции в логические модули. Библиотеки предоставляют подготовленные методы для повторяющихся операций, что ускоряет разработку в казино онлайн.

Каждая инструкция имеет конкретное применение. Директива присваивания фиксирует данные в буфер. Директива вывода выводит сведения на мониторе. Арифметические команды выполняют числовые операции.

Архитектура скрипта воздействует на ее понятность. Качественно структурированный скрипт легче читать и корректировать. Пояснения способствуют объяснить роль конкретных фрагментов.

Ключевые элементы: переменные, условия, циклы

Переменные являются резервуарами для размещения данных вулкан в приложении. Каждая переменная обладает обозначение и величину. Величина способно варьироваться в течении работы кода. Типы информации устанавливают, какую сведения содержит переменная: числа, символы или булевы значения.

Условные операторы позволяют программе принимать выборы. Оператор условия контролирует истинность формулы. Если требование удовлетворяется, программа производит один участок команд. В противном варианте программа производит альтернативный секцию.

Цикл реализует секцию инструкций неоднократно до соблюдения условия. Итерация со переменной воспроизводит действия определённое объём итераций. Повтор с проверкой осуществляет исполнение, пока критерий является верным.

Совокупность переменных, условий и итераций образует эффективные схемы. Переменные содержат временные данные подсчётов. Условия определяют выполнение программы по разным траекториям. Повторы обрабатывают крупные количества данных без дублирования кода. Усвоение этих концепций крайне необходимо для разработчика онлайн казино. Основные элементы существуют во всех языках программирования.

Как работает логика в программе

Логика программирования построена на булевской алгебре. Булевы величины получают только два значения: истинность или фальшь. Булевские команды сравнивают сведения и предоставляют булев итог. Оператор равенства анализирует идентичность значений. Операторы сравнения фиксируют соотношения больше, меньше или идентично.

Логические выражения сочетают несколько критериев. Оператор И нуждается выполнения всех проверок совместно. Оператор ИЛИ срабатывает при верности хотя бы одного требования. Оператор НЕ переворачивает логическое величину на обратное.

Разветвление даёт программе выбирать путь работы в казино вулкан. Элементарное ветвление имеет одно условие и два варианта шагов. Сложное разветвление тестирует несколько условий по порядку.

Старшинство действий влияет на очерёдность обработки конструкций. Скобки корректируют базовый очерёдность исполнения действий. Правильная расстановка первенств исключает алгоритмические ошибки.

Логическое мышление помогает программисту предусмотреть различные ситуации. Испытание логики анализирует корректность работы проверок. Чёткая алгоритмическая конструкция создаёт приложение стабильной и предсказуемой.

Почему важно усваивать алгоритмы

Алгоритм представляет собой последовательную инструкцию для разрешения проблемы. Всякая утилита воплощает определённый алгоритм. Уровень алгоритма устанавливает производительность выполнения программы. Неэффективный способ снижает исполнение даже на сильном аппаратуре.

Понимание схем тренирует системное мышление программиста. Специалист овладевает делить трудные проблемы на элементарные действия. Методический подход пригоден не только в казино онлайн, но и в бытовых проблемах.

Существует несколько критериев оценки алгоритмов:

  • Точность — способ дает верный ответ для всех входящих информации.
  • Производительность выполнения — период работы при разнообразных объемах сведений.
  • Применение памяти — число ресурсов для сохранения результатов.
  • Лёгкость реализации — ясность и восприятие программы.

Владение известных методов экономит время разработки. Сортировка, поиск, перебор структур информации — повторяющиеся задания обладают отработанные варианты.

Системное мышление необходимо на собеседованиях. Наниматели контролируют умение претендента выполнять логические проблемы. Умение выбрать оптимальный метод отличает профессионального программиста от начинающего.

Как воспринимать и создавать базовый программу

Чтение стороннего программы берёт начало с осознания целостной конструкции утилиты. Кодер сначала рассматривает ключевые блоки и их связи. Аннотации способствуют уяснить функцию отдельных частей. Обозначения переменных и функций должны отражать их суть.

Формирование доступного скрипта нуждается соблюдения норм форматирования. Отступы демонстрируют иерархию блоков команд. Интервалы возле инструкций улучшают визуальное восприятие. Каждая строка призвана включать одну логическую действие.

Начинающим полезно рассматривать варианты программы опытных кодеров. Исследование подготовленных решений показывает правильные подходы к структурированию в казино вулкан. Заимствование удачных приёмов вырабатывает индивидуальный стиль написания приложений.

Лаконичный программа выполняет задачу простейшими инструментами. Избыточная усложнённость осложняет понимание программы. Дробление больших подпрограмм на короткие оптимизирует организацию. Каждая процедура должна исполнять одну определённую задачу.

Упражнение написания кода совершенствует умения программирования. Ежедневные тренировки фиксируют синтаксис языка. Разбор небольших проблем совершенствует рациональное мышление. Постепенное увеличение упражнений увеличивает уровень квалификации.

Ошибки и проверка утилит

Ошибки в приложениях делятся на несколько типов. Грамматические ошибки образуются при игнорировании правил языка программирования. Компилятор обнаруживает такие погрешности до запуска приложения. Алгоритмические дефекты выражаются в неверной выполнении кода при корректном синтаксисе.

Исправление является собой ход отыскания и устранения неточностей. Отладчик позволяет пошагово выполнять программу и контролировать за варьированием переменных. Маркеры останова прерывают выполнение в заданных фрагментах кода. Контроль величин содействует уяснить корень некорректного поведения в вулкан.

Печать временных итогов упрощает обнаружение ошибок. Кодер вставляет команды отображения для проверки значений. Проверка напечатанных информации указывает, где программа функционирует неверно.

Методический подход ускоряет течение отладки. Изоляция ошибочного участка сужает область отыскания. Проверка граничных значений раскрывает дефекты в проверках. Тестирование отдельных функций способствует определить неполадки.

Опыт взаимодействия с погрешностями развивает специализированные умения. Каждая устранённая дефект помогает предотвращать схожих дефектов. Способность оперативно обнаруживать и ликвидировать неточности ценится компаниями.

С чего начать изучение разработке

Определение начального языка программирования обусловлен от задач обучения. Python подходит для новичков вследствие простому синтаксису. JavaScript требуется для создания динамических веб-страниц. Java применяется в промышленных программах.

Веб-платформы дают упорядоченные уроки для начинающих. Практические задания фиксируют теоретические сведения на деле. Видеокурсы объясняют трудные идеи простым стилем. Форумы содействуют обрести разъяснения на запросы в казино онлайн.

Активное разработка формирует практические навыки. Формирование простых работ реализует усвоенную базу. Калькулятор, перечень задач, элементарная игра — подходящие первые проекты. Деятельность над персональными идеями мотивирует продолжать обучение.

Периодичность упражнений значимее длительности одной занятия. Постоянная практика по тридцать минут результативнее нечастых протяжённых занятий. Плавное усложнение проблем предупреждает выгорание.

Анализ документации формирует автономность программиста. Формальная документация хранит полную информацию о способностях языка. Способность находить данные ускоряет решение заданий и формирование компетенций.

Scroll to Top